Superficial and deep cervical plexus block: technical considerations
Cervical plexus blocks offer a safe anesthetic alternative for neck and head surgeries. Both superficial and deep blocks provide effective pain management with minimal side effects, increasing their popularity.

Background:
- Cervical plexus block is an alternative to general anesthesia for specific surgical sites.
- Superficial block targets sensory nerves; deep block targets both sensory and motor nerves.
- Deep cervical plexus blocks are associated with minor, transient side effects.

Main Results:
- Cervical plexus block is a safe and effective anesthetic option for neck, upper shoulder, and occipital scalp surgery.
- Superficial block allows isolated sensory blockade, while deep block provides both sensory and motor blockade.
- Deep blocks have minor, transient side effects that are rarely consequential.
Conclusions:
- Cervical plexus block is a valuable anesthetic option for clinicians.
- Increased popularity for procedures like carotid endarterectomy.
- Understanding anatomy is key to successful implementation.
